E-bike rider says he has been run off multi-modal paths by golf carts

To the Editor:

As an owner of two E-bikes and riding the multi-modal paths I am always considerate of others when sharing the paths. I wish that some golf cart drivers would be as considerate.
I have been run off the paths by passing carts cutting me off, carts have pulled out in front of me and my wife creating near misses, we’ve been sworn at by cart drivers because they think the paths are made for them. Even once we were passed in a tunnel by a woman obviously in hurry to get to a ladies luncheon.
So much for the The Villages being the friendliest town.
What’s the hurry? Why possibly injure or maim someone over being a minute or two later? If it’s that important why not leave a few minutes earlier.

Larry Bennett
Village of Tall Trees
